Replication in service oriented architectures

被引:0
|
作者
Ameling, Michael [1 ]
Roy, Marcus [1 ]
Kemme, Bettina [2 ]
机构
[1] SAP Res CEC Dresden, Chemnitzer Str 48, Dresden, Germany
[2] McGill Univ, Sch Comp Sci, Montreal, PQ, Canada
关键词
application server; replication; Web Service; simulation;
D O I
暂无
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Multi-tier architectures have become the main building block in service-oriented architecture solutions with stringent requirements on performance and reliability. Replicating the reusable software components of the business logic and the application dependent state of business data is a promising means to provide fast local access and high availability. However, while replication of databases is a well explored area and the implications of replica maintenance are well understood, this is not the case for data replication in application servers where entire business objects are replicated, Web Service interfaces are provided, main memory access is much more prevalent, and which have a database server as a backend tier. In this paper, we introduce possible replication architectures for multi-tier architectures, and identify the parameters influencing the performance. We present a simulation prototype that is suitable to integrate and compare several replication solutions. We describe in detail one solution that seems to be the most promising in a wide-area setting.
引用
收藏
页码:103 / +
页数:2
相关论文
共 50 条
  • [1] Replication of business objects in service oriented architectures
    Ameling, Michael
    [J]. DCSOFT 2008: PROCEEDINGS OF THE DOCTORAL CONSORTIUM ON SOFTWARE AND DATA TECHNOLOGIES, 2008, : 74 - 85
  • [2] Understanding and Evaluating Replication in Service Oriented Multi-tier Architectures
    Ameling, Michael
    Roy, Marcus
    Kemme, Bettina
    [J]. SOFTWARE AND DATA TECHNOLOGIES, 2009, 47 : 91 - +
  • [3] ASMs in Service Oriented Architectures
    Altenhofen, Michael
    Friesen, Andreas
    Lemcke, Jens
    [J]. JOURNAL OF UNIVERSAL COMPUTER SCIENCE, 2008, 14 (12) : 2034 - 2058
  • [4] On optimal service selection in Service Oriented Architectures
    Menasce, Daniel A.
    Casalicchio, Emiliano
    Dubey, Vinod
    [J]. PERFORMANCE EVALUATION, 2010, 67 (08) : 659 - 675
  • [5] Tradeoffs in Testing Service Oriented Architectures
    Sloan, John C.
    Khoshgoftaar, Taghi M.
    [J]. 14TH ISSAT INTERNATIONAL CONFERENCE ON RELIABILITY AND QUALITY IN DESIGN, PROCEEDINGS, 2008, : 141 - 145
  • [6] Mobile service oriented architectures (MOSOA)
    Van Gurp, Jilles
    Karhinen, Anssi
    Bosch, Jan
    [J]. DISTRIBUTED APPLICATIONS AND INTEROPERABLE SYSTEMS, PROCEEDINGS, 2006, 4025 : 1 - 15
  • [7] A Model of Service-Oriented Architectures
    Malkis, Alexander
    Marmsoler, Diego
    [J]. PROCEEDINGS 2015 NINTH BRAZILIAN SYMPOSIUM ON SOFTWARE COMPONENTS, ARCHITECTURES AND REUSE - SBCARS 2015, 2015, : 110 - 119
  • [8] Process Reliability in Service Oriented Architectures
    Schuller, Dieter
    Papageorgiou, Apostolos
    Schulte, Stefan
    Eckert, Julian
    Repp, Nicolas
    Steinmetz, Ralf
    [J]. 2009 3RD IEEE INTERNATIONAL CONFERENCE ON DIGITAL ECOSYSTEMS AND TECHNOLOGIES, 2009, : 453 - 458
  • [9] Clouds and service-oriented architectures
    Liu, Lu
    Xu, Jie
    [J]. F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F GRID COMPUTING AND ESCIENCE, 2013, 29 (01): : 271 - 272
  • [10] Securing Tactical Service Oriented Architectures
    Gkioulos, Vasileios
    Wolthusen, Stephen D.
    [J]. 2016 INTERNATIONAL CONFERENCE ON SECURITY OF SMART CITIES, INDUSTRIAL CONTROL SYSTEM AND COMMUNICATIONS (SSIC), 2016,